Quick notes from the records huddle. The replacement lock for the basement safe finally shipped from Ironquill Security — it's the dial-and-key hybrid model we asked for, not the keypad one, so no batteries to fuss over. Install is booked for Friday morning; old lock gets bagged and archived per retention policy, because of course it does. The lock arrives by bonded courier sometime Thursday. When the courier shows up, hand over goes per the line below.

dispatch memo: the eliok quenok courier leaves the sorael aldath belion tammir casix gileth queniel jorath ledger at gate 9299 under passcode 897989

- [ ] Step 7: Archive cold storage buckets (Glacierline tier). Confirm both ceremony witnesses are present, verify bucket manifests match the Oxbow ledger, then seal the archive key shares. Plugin authors may observe but not handle shares. Once sealed, the archive index itself is encrypted and can only be reopened with the passphrase below.

vault phrase of badup-hahig = tamael-aldael-kelmir-istael-fenok-istwyn-tamius-jorath-oliion

**Mgmt Meeting Minutes — Retiring the Brightline Range**

Quick recap for sales leads at Fenholt Supplies: we agreed to retire the Brightline fixture range by year-end. Remaining stock moves to clearance pricing next month, and accounts on standing orders get migrated to the Lumetta range. Trade-in incentives were approved in principle. The confidential note on next steps sits just below.

board note of bajof-bajeg: The pricing group signed off on a budget of $13.4 million for Project Sildor. The renewal with Lamixek Holdings closes at $48.9 million a year, 49 percent above the last contract.

Hey Tomas,

Handing off the Ladleworks recipe-scaling calculator before my week off. The scaling math runs in the app tier, but conversion tables (cups, grams, oddball units) live in the units_db schema. If scaling results look off, check the factor cache first — it refreshes nightly. Nothing else should page you. The connection string for the primary is below.

database URL for kahip-tawep: postgresql://druix_svc:XpEf7Qn4IltxYW@db-9d5d.urlaqtech.corp:5432/sorwyn